Pogo ‘boss’ Huang Ziyang flew to Hong Kong – Sen. Gatchalian

MANILA, Philippines — Huang Ziyang, believed to be a central figure in the establishment of Philippine offshore gaming operators (Pogos) in Pampanga and Tarlac, has fled to Hong Kong according to Sen. Sherwin Gatchalian. 

“Nabalitaan namin na nasa Hong Kong siya ngayon. From Taiwan, kakalipad lang niya ng Hong Kong, so makikita natin na gumagalaw siya,” Gatchalian told reporters in a press conference on Thursday. 

(We learned that he is now in Hong Kong. From Taiwan, he flew to Hong Kong so we can see that he’s actively moving.)

Citing documents found on raided Pogo facilities in Pampanga and Tarlac,  Gatchalian said it is evident that Huang Ziyang is connected to these raided firms. 

“Importante na ma-file natin yung case at tumakbo na ‘yung case para tumakbo na ‘yung formal warrant of arrest dito sa ating bansa at para ma-alert na natin ‘yung Interpol at malilimitahan na rin ‘yung kanyang galaw,” said the senator. 

(It’s important that we file a case against him and that progress be made on this case in order for a formal warrant of arrest here in the Philippines be issued. With this, we can alert the Interpol to limit his movements.)

Gatchalian said it’s unclear whether or not Huang Ziyang is the “boss of all bosses of Pogos.”

The lawmaker, however, made it clear that this Chinese individual is already a top-ranking official involved in the proliferation of these hubs. 

“So far, hindi ko pa siya masabi na siya yung pinaka big boss. But so far boss siya, so far nakikita namin involved siya sa tatlong Pogo hub na ‘yun. If you look at geography, magkakatabi lang ito eh, ang Porac, ang Fontana, at Bamban,” he said. 

(So far, I cannot say if he is the big boss. But so far, he is a boss. We’ve seen that he is involved in the three Pogo hubs. If you look at geography, Porac, Fontana, and Bamban are just adjacent to each other.)
